Spain's Defense Minister Emphasizes Country's Contributions to NATO
Spanish Defense Minister Margarita Robles met with her Portuguese counterpart, Nuno Melo, in Lisbon to highlight Spain's contributions to NATO. The two ministers emphasized the economic and labor opportunities presented by the Spanish defense industry and the country's commitment to cybersecurity and dual technology. Robles noted that Spain has already reached 2% of GDP on defense spending, a goal set by NATO, and expressed gratitude for the efforts of Spanish military personnel serving in international missions and headquarters around the world.

- The Enhanced Vigilance Neptune Strike (NEST) is planned and executed in two months through the integration of aircraft carrier strike groups.
- The Baltic Operations are the main maritime exercise in the Baltic Sea, with Spain participating with the Dedalo Expeditionary Group in 2024.
- Spain contributes an F-100 Frigate to the Formidable Shield exercise, which tests the interoperability of different allied weapon systems in ballistic missile defense scenarios.
- Thousands of Spanish military personnel serve in NATO headquarters and international missions around the world, with 20 Spaniards working at the headquarters of STRIKFORNATO, mostly in the operations area.
